<h3>Naming organic compounds</h3>
In the naming of organic compounds, some fundamental rules come into practice. Some of these rules include:
- The longest carbon chain, otherwise known as the parent chain, is considered.
- The substituents must be identified
- The parent chain should be named such that the substituents are located on the lowest-numbered carbons. Repeated substituents are named accordingly.
- Different substituents are named alphabetically and substituents with lower alphabets are considered for the lowest-numbered carbons.

These 2 are techniques whereby an individual tries to analyze and observe additional data points or information that may not be recorded and or obvious. From a graph, usually linear.
Interpolation involves the individual to be aware of the pattern observed or relationship between the 2 variables and tries to obtain a value that is in between 2 recorded or defined data points.
Extrapolation involves the individual to estimate and imagine what the graph would appear as if further data was collected, based on the previous recordings. This can be found out due to the relationship between the 2 variables in the graph.
